#b3f8c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3f8c0 is composed of 70.2% red, 97.3%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.6%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 83.7%. #b3f8c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#67f181.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#b3f8c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3f8c0 has RGB values of R:179, G:248,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 11794624.

Shades and Tints of #b3f8c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e04 is the darkest color, while #fbf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3f8c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d3d8d4 is the less saturated color, while #adfebc is the most saturated one.
